Withington and Foden's end four year partnership

The musical partnership between conductor Allan Withington and Foden's Band has come to an end.

4BR has been informed that the musical partnership between conductor Allan Withington and Foden's Band has come to an end.

Four year period

The decision brings to a close a four year period that saw the Sandbach band and their Norwegian based MD achieve considerable contesting success as well as concert and recording acclaim — including a historic British Open/National Championship 'Double' in 2012.

Run its course

Allan told 4BR: "The partnership with Foden's has now run its course as we found ourselves in disagreement as to the form any future development of the band was to take.

I would like to thank Foden's for an interesting four years and I will now concentrate on my playing and conducting alongside work commitments both in Norway and on the continent."

Enjoyed

Foden's Band Mark Wilkinson added: "All at Foden's would like to thank Allan for his four year association with us.

During this time we have enjoyed working with him on a number of projects as well as contest performances and have always found him to be extremely musical, professional and well prepared.

The obvious highlight was in 2012 when were crowned 'Double Champions', but both parties have decided that now is the right time to part company but do so on the best of terms and have not ruled out working together in the future."

No appointment

4BR understands that no decision has been taken by the band on the appointment of a new professional Musical Director, or to who will take the band to the 2016 North West Regional Championship in February in Blackpool.
